Latest Patents

One of Shigenori Wada's latest inventions includes a sophisticated watt-hour meter designed for precise measurement of integrated electric power. This meter converts first and second input signals representing analog electric current and analog voltage of an alternating current into digital signals. A first adder within the meter produces a sum signal that combines the first input signal with an additional analog signal of a different frequency. The meter also features a second adder for further enhancement, which adds another additional analog signal to the second input signal. Additionally, it may incorporate low-pass filters and oversample-and-convert circuits to ensure accurate digital signal production. In a refinement, the meter includes a first inverter that can invert selected input signals, enhancing its versatility.

Career Highlights

Shigenori Wada has a notable career, having worked with prominent companies such as NEC Corporation and The Tokyo Electric Power Company, Incorporated. His professional journey reflects his dedication to advancing electrical engineering practices through innovative inventions.
